Transaction 6568d865029210eff823878b6ac04a7c45a3a9f9c71cbba5105ae470667aadb7
1 Input
1 Output
-
6568d865029210eff823878b6ac04a7c45a3a9f9c71cbba5105ae470667aadb7:0
- value
- 7966018
- script pubkey
- OP_0 OP_PUSHBYTES_20 73c0256cacfc86d8d0bb65be1c0e6ed45258cdd5
- address
- bc1qw0qz2m9vljrd359mvklpcrnw63f93nw46skl5r